I flew into DC for URISA 07 on Monday. I read through the program on the flight and noticed a lot of the same names on the papers scheduled. I spoke ot one vendor on the floor who sheepishly admitted he was giving 4 papers. As I blog this evening I got a card from Autodesk. One of its reps is speaking 3 times.
Another thing I noticed: Very few papers, perhaps three, explicitly note speaking to integration with GAMY (Google, Ask, Microsoft, Yahoo). There is a round table lunch topic titled MAGY on Tuesday.
Finally, down at registration there are tables with magazines. There were three: GPS World, Governing and Government Technology. With but one U.S. GIS magazine still in print, it was nice to see some of the electronic ones represented in the registration materials.
